Multi-layered screening starts with perimeter security, where RFID badge readers verify employee status and facial-recognition cameras cross-check against watch-lists. At the 2023 Coachella festival, organizers deployed over 1,200 RFID scanners and reduced tailgating incidents by 38% compared with the previous year.

Inside the venue, metal detectors and handheld scanners serve as the second layer. The U.S. Department of Homeland Security documented that 68% of weapons intercepted at large gatherings were identified through secondary screening devices in 2022. Pairing these tools with a data-driven risk matrix helps allocate resources where the probability of a breach is highest.

Cutting-edge technology amplifies human vigilance. AI video-analytics platforms, such as VigilantEye, flag loitering or rapid movements and alert security staff within seconds. A pilot at the 2024 Oscars demonstrated a 2.5-fold reduction in response time to potential threats, from an average of 12 seconds to under five seconds.

Shooting prevention hinges on predictive analytics. The FBI’s Uniform Crime Reporting Program recorded 1,274 mass-shooting incidents between 2010 and 2020, with 55% occurring in public venues. By analyzing social-media chatter and ticket-purchase patterns, security teams can flag high-risk individuals before they reach the venue. The 2022 NBA All-Star Game employed a threat-scoring algorithm that identified three high-risk profiles; all were denied entry after secondary interviews.

High-profile venue security benefits from real-time communication hubs. Integrated command centers link on-site officers, local law enforcement and travel-strategist liaisons via encrypted radio and push-notification systems. During the 2023 Cannes Film Festival, the central hub coordinated 42 simultaneous security actions, from crowd control to VIP convoy routing, without a single reported incident.

"Events that adopted a unified command structure saw a 30% drop in incident escalation rates," the International Association of Venue Managers reported in its 2023 annual survey.

Proactive travel-strategist coordination also includes contingency planning for transportation disruptions. Scenario-based drills simulate road closures, weather events or cyber-attacks on ticketing platforms. After a simulated cyber-attack on the ticketing system for the 2024 Summer Olympics, the travel team adjusted routing within 15 minutes, preserving the safety of 12,000 athletes and officials.

Finally, continuous improvement loops ensure that lessons learned translate into future protocols. Post-event debriefs collect data from surveillance logs, biometric scans and traveler feedback. This data feeds machine-learning models that refine threat-scoring thresholds for subsequent events.
